Structural characteristics of clamp type check valves and installation precautions for clamp type check valves

2023 12/11

The clamp type check valve is a universal one-way fluid valve. It is lightweight, small in size, and easy to install between flanges. The valve is composed of two semi-circular springs and a plate surface inside, which are fixed on the valve body with pins. The spring deformation causes the valve plate to close, and the fluid pressure causes the opening spring to deform quickly, which can protect the pipeline from water hammer damage.

The disc stroke of the clamp check valve is short, the disc is lightweight, and it has spring assisted closing, resulting in a fast closing speed. The structural length is short, the volume is small, the weight is light, the fluid resistance is small, the sealing is reliable, the opening and closing are stable, wear-resistant, the service life is long, the oil pressure and slow closing are not affected by the medium, and have good energy-saving effects. It brings great convenience to the installation, handling, storage, and pipeline layout of valves, and can save a lot of materials and reduce costs.

Installation precautions for clamp type check valves

1. When placing pipelines, attention should be paid to ensuring that the direction of passage of the clamp type check valve is consistent with the flow direction of the fluid;

2. Installed in vertically placed pipelines, for horizontally placed pipelines, vertically place clamp type check valves;

3. Use an expansion pipe between the clamp type check valve and butterfly valve, and never directly connect it to other valves;

4. Within the operating radius of the valve plate, avoid adding pipe joints and blockages;

5. Do not install a variable diameter pipe in front or behind the clamp type check valve;

6. When installing a clamp type check valve near the elbow, it is important to leave sufficient space;

7. When installing a clamp type check valve at the outlet of the water pump, at least six times the diameter of the valve should flow out to ensure that the butterfly plate is finally subjected to fluid action.


The H71H and H71W clamp lift check valves use a new type of material, which is corrosion-resistant stainless steel or carbon steel. It can be installed on any position of the pipeline to prevent medium backflow. The boiler feedwater system is connected by clamping the flanges at both ends of the original pipeline, which can be put into operation. Its various indicators are superior to any currently available upstream valve. It is widely used in water supply and drainage, fire protection, construction, HVAC, and industrial systems. All media such as water, gas, oil, acid, alkali, hydrogen, ammonia, and special fire pipelines can be used. For example, it can be installed at the outlet of the water pump to avoid water hammer, water hammer sound, and destructive impact, achieving the purpose of preventing backflow and protecting equipment, with good energy-saving effect.
